Transaction 838395517b3aef515e36fa15f8a7131837d65a7d6d046382a4c15a420df08930

2 Input
2 Outputs
  • 838395517b3aef515e36fa15f8a7131837d65a7d6d046382a4c15a420df08930:0
  • value  119610
    address  122G9CfPdbRhfpmyb4VtQEoCdHJ1Ra6Bk3
  • 838395517b3aef515e36fa15f8a7131837d65a7d6d046382a4c15a420df08930:1
  • value  30000000
    address  188x8wTs99g5PcAbQAnmabMDn9JQ8p3PuW